The 2018 movie Venom, which stars Tom Hardy in the lead role, was one of those films that divided critics and audiences.

While critics gave it mostly bad reviews, even calling it “the worst Marvel-derived origin story ever,” moviegoers rushed to the theaters to watch it. Venom ended up making $855 million at the box office and got propelled to No.5 on the list of highest grossing movies of 2018.

All of this caught the attention of the crew behind the YouTube channel Screen Junkies, who decided to use Venom as the topic of the latest entry in their hugely popular series Honest Trailers.

The Venom honest trailer mostly serves as an entertaining and funny look at the movie which has plenty of both good and bad aspects. It praises and criticizes Hardy’s performances, makes fun of romantic scenes and much more.

With that being said, there are several solid arguments made in the trailer, including the one that says Venom should be an R-rated movie given the history of the character and the dark tone of its comics. On the other hand, the movie was an absolute hit, so PG-13 was definitely the right choice from a financial standpoint.

Most reviews are telling us that Venom is no good. Magazines like Variety and The Hollywood Reporter are calling it “forgettable,” “unimaginative,” and “generically plotted.” Is that the truth? Well, yes and no.

Even though critics are trashing Venom, the audience is still buying tickets and going to see this Tom Hardy-starred feature. The reason for that is good word of mouth, since casual moviegoers are not nitpicking Venom or trying hard to find its flaws. They just want to have great fun when they go to the cinema, and this movie provides precisely that.

Don’t get us wrong. Venom is filled with flaws and question marks, starting from the thin plot to an unconvincing performance by some members of the cast. The first part of the movie is unnecessarily stretched, and it looks like someone realized this at one point and then tried to speed up the story all of a sudden. This compensation caused a bit of an unnatural transition which probably won’t bother lot of people.

For people who don’t need complex stories, perfect directing or iconic performances from actors to have a satisfying movie experience, Venom is a must-watch film. Despite being far from perfect, the movie is simply fun. It has great visual effects, tons of action and really smart humor. Also, Tom Hardy delivers an inspired performance as Eddie Brock, especially when he is leading talks in his head with symbiote Venom.

We recommend that you don’t pay much attention to the plot details and question how something happened since you’ll discover a lot of holes. Instead, lean back, put your brain to rest and just get immersed in the experience that Venom offers. This way you’ll get your money’s worth and much more while looking forward to the planned sequels.
